    I really don’t understand why is this an issue with some people.
    Has anyone seen X-Men Red #3 cover:
    https://shop.coliseumofcomics.com/co...variant-leg-mo
    This cover picture looks older than Tatum.

    Paul Rudd was 47 in the first Ant Man
    RDJ was 43 in the first Iorn Man
    Chadwick Boseman was 38 in Civil War and 40 in Black Panther.
    As far as Reynolds, the Wolverine version doesn’t count anymore.
    He now became Deadpool in the 2016 movie when he was 39
    Chris Pratt was 35 in the first GOTG.
    So, Tatum being 38 or 39 is no big deal.
